    • Close Multiple Sclerosis (MS)
      Type: Seconday Progressive MS

      I am a 35-year old woman living with multiple sclerosis now for 14 years. I was diagnosed the summer before my Junior Year of college. I had yet to declare a major, and thus hearing my possible diagnosis, chose Education in case I would not ever be capable of having children of my own. For the first ten years I showed relatively no signs of the disease. I began walking with a cane 5 years ago, and now for about the past year, a walker. My MS has progressed over the past year and a half.

      Treatments

      Baclofen Somewhat Helpful
      It somewhat helps with the spasticity
      Betaseron Working / Worked
      It worked for about 7 years or so.
      Prednisone Working / Worked
      Prednisone treatments always helped, but only temporarily, while I was taking it.
      Tysabri Too Soon to Tell
      I have only had 3 infusions at this point.
